I have a Bantam BC6 6 cell charger/balancer and I am thinking of picking up a new heli running a 10c 1p pack (flightpower). What is the best option for me to do charging wise. Do I need to buy a new 10c charger/balancer or is there a way I can buy and external balancer for the BC6 and charge at a slower rate?
